Summary

Our client VD Safety Systems, based in Enfield, South Australia, is seeking to add a Fire Protection Equipment Technician to support the installation, testing and maintenance of essential fire protection equipment and safety systems. The role will assist with reliable inspection, servicing and compliance-related work across fire extinguishers, hose reels, hydrants, blankets, exit lighting and associated fire safety equipment.

The typical job responsibilities will include, but are not limited to the following:

- Install and service portable fire extinguishers across commercial and industrial client sites.
- Inspect and maintain fire hose reels, hydrants and fire blankets.
- Test exit lighting and emergency safety equipment in accordance with requirements.
- Complete routine maintenance checks on fire protection equipment and systems.
- Identify defects, faults or non-compliant equipment during scheduled service visits.
- Prepare accurate service reports, inspection records and maintenance documentation.
- Replace, recharge or repair fire extinguishers and related safety equipment.
- Assist with passive fire and smoke containment system inspection tasks.
- Maintain safe work practices while operating at client premises and worksites.
- Use appropriate tools, testing equipment and safety procedures for each task.
- Communicate clearly with clients regarding service findings and required follow-up work.
- Ensure work is completed in line with relevant fire safety standards.
- Maintain vehicle stock, equipment, labels,



tags and service materials.
- Advise building owners about new fire protection equipment and systems as per industry standard.
- Support scheduled servicing programmes and urgent repair or maintenance requests .
- Capacity to work independently across client locations while maintaining safe, industry standard and professional work practices.
